Welcome to Jenson ...

Jenson is located in Bell County<1>.



While we don't have a date for the founding of Jenson, you might consider that their post office opened  in 1927.

Jenson is 1,030 feet [314 m] above sea level.<2>.

Time Zone: Jenson lies in the Eastern Time Zone (EST/EDT) and observes daylight saving time

Jenson lies within the (606) area code.
